Patient's Oral Health Condition

At Herident, we frequently encounter cases of elderly patients experiencing severe periodontal problems. A typical case was a patient who presented with teeth #26 and #27 (two upper left molars) exhibiting Grade III mobility. This condition not only caused significant difficulty in daily chewing but also posed an imminent risk of early tooth loss due to alveolar bone resorption and periapical lesions. Therefore, the patient came to Herident seeking definitive treatment for the loose teeth condition and a stable restoration of their chewing function.

  • Teeth #26 and #27 with Grade III mobility.
  • Alveolar bone loss due to chronic periodontitis.
  • The remaining bone was too thin and too close to the maxillary sinus, insufficient for placing a standard implant.

This is a rather common situation among elderly patients, where periodontitis progresses silently over a long period. By the time the teeth become noticeably loose and the patient recognizes the problem, the jawbone has already been severely destroyed.

Detail Diagnosis

After a thorough clinical examination and taking Conebeam CT (CBCT) scans (a 3D diagnostic imaging technique that allows doctors to clearly visualize the jawbone structure, teeth, and surrounding tissues), the doctors at Herident provided a detailed diagnosis of the patient's condition:

  • Teeth #26 and #27 exhibited severe mobility (Grade III), indicating a serious weakening of the periodontal ligaments supporting the teeth.
  • Significant alveolar bone loss was present around the roots of teeth #26 and #27, a direct consequence of prolonged periodontitis.
  • The height and thickness of the jawbone at the location of teeth #26, #27 were insufficient to ensure stability for the implant post upon placement. Specifically, the jawbone was at risk of perforation into the maxillary sinus, a hollow structure within the facial bones, which would cause complications if implant placement were attempted without support.

Comprehensive Treatment Plan

Based on the diagnostic results, the team of experts at Herident developed a personalized treatment plan, combining multiple advanced dental techniques to comprehensively address the patient's condition and restore chewing function. Under the direction of PhD, MD Dang Trieu Hung, the treatment plan included the following steps:

  • Extraction of teeth #26, #27: This is a necessary step to completely eliminate the source of infection, clean out the existing pathological tissues, and create favorable conditions for the subsequent treatment process.
  • Open Sinus Lift: This is a complex surgical technique indicated when the jawbone height is insufficient. The surgeon will create a small "window" in the lateral wall of the maxillary sinus, gently lift the sinus membrane, and then place bone graft material into this created space. The purpose is to increase the bone height and volume, creating a stable foundation for future implant placement.
  • Bone Grafting: Using artificial bone material or combining with growth factors from the patient's body (such as PRF membrane) to optimize the bone regeneration process.
  • Implant Placement: After a period of healing and bone integration (typically 6-9 months after the sinus lift surgery), the implant posts will be placed at the location of teeth #26 and #27. Placing the implants at this time will ensure the posts have sufficient stability and optimal osseointegration.
  • Fixed Porcelain Restoration: Finally, porcelain crowns will be fabricated and permanently fixed onto the implant posts, completely restoring the shape, chewing function, and aesthetics for the molar region.

The total estimated treatment time is expected to last about 6-9 months, depending on the patient's healing capacity and bone integration.

What is Open Sinus Lift?

Open sinus lift is a specialized dental surgical technique, applied in cases where patients have severe alveolar bone resorption in the upper molar region, resulting in insufficient bone height for implant placement.

  • This technique involves the surgeon creating a small opening (window) on the lateral wall of the maxillary sinus.
  • Afterward, the mucous membrane lining the sinus is gently lifted, creating a space.
  • Artificial bone material, or sometimes combined with the patient's own bone, will be placed into this space to fill it and increase the height of the jawbone.
  • The healing and bone integration process usually takes 6 to 9 months. After this time, the grafted bone will become solid, forming a stable foundation for placing the implant post.

Unlike the closed sinus lift technique (often used when the remaining bone height is about 4-5mm), the open sinus lift is indicated when the bone height is less than 3mm. This is a procedure that demands high technical skill, meticulousness, and extensive experience from the surgeon. However, it provides long-lasting effectiveness, definitively resolving the most complex clinical cases.

Procedure for Open Sinus Lift, Bone Grafting, and Implant Placement

Detail Procedure

The procedure for this clinical case at Herident adheres to standardized steps, ensuring safety and optimal results:

1. Examination and Diagnostic Imaging:

  • The doctor conducts a clinical examination, checking the condition of the loose teeth, gums, and bone.
  • Take Conebeam CT (CBCT) scans to accurately assess the jawbone structure, bone height and thickness, position of the maxillary sinus, and important anatomical structures.

2. Treatment Planning:

  • Based on the diagnostic results, the doctor provides detailed consultation to the patient regarding their condition, feasible treatment options, pros and cons, and expected outcomes.
  • Finalize the treatment plan, which includes tooth extraction, sinus lift with bone grafting, implant placement, and porcelain restoration.

3. Surgical Procedure:

  • Local anesthesia: Ensures the patient is comfortable and feels no pain throughout the surgical procedure.
  • Extraction of teeth #26, #27: Perform the extraction gently, preserving the surrounding bone tissue as much as possible.
  • Open Sinus Lift Surgery: The doctor makes a small incision in the gum to access the lateral wall of the maxillary sinus. Create a bone window, lift the sinus membrane, and insert the artificial bone material. This process is performed under strict sterile conditions.
  • Wound Closure: Suture the incision using absorbable stitches or stitches that require subsequent removal.

4. Healing and Bone Integration Phase:

  • Patient follows the doctor's instructions for wound care, taking pain relievers and antibiotics (if needed).
  • After about 6-9 months, the bone graft will integrate with the native jawbone, forming a solid mass. The doctor will re-evaluate with X-rays or Conebeam CT scans.

5. Implant Placement

Once the bone is sufficient, the doctor proceeds with the surgery to place the implant posts into the prepared site.

6. Porcelain Restoration

  • After the implant has fully integrated with the bone (usually several weeks to several months after implant placement, depending on the implant type), the doctor will take dental impressions and fabricate the porcelain crowns.
  • Finally, the porcelain crowns are permanently fixed onto the implant posts, completing the restoration process.
